      I've been emailing back & forth with Richard from The Shoe Healer (who has been very helpful btw) regarding the sizing of the Stow boot. Brannock devices put me at a US 11C, my only proper dress shoes, a pair of Florsheim Kenmoors, are a US 11D, and my Clarks DBs are a US 10.5. Richard says could wear a 9.5 or 10, fitting 5, depending. Anyone here have advice that might sway me one way or the other?  Thanks!

      I have a couple of questions regarding the sizing of this shirt. I've never owned any IH tops & I don't have anywhere local to try them on, but figured someone here would probably have advice.

      1. Sizing: I'm 6'1", 165lbs, cyclist's build.  I measured a shirt from J.Crew that I consider well-fitting, if a bit slim. The sleeves are probably too short, but I generally roll them, and the top button always pulls a bit tight because I'm sort of barrel-chested for someone so thin.

      Size S
      shoulder: 17.7
      pit-to-pit: 20.5
      length: 29.7
      arm: 24.6

      Does this put me in a M?  L?  Obviously, M would be ideal, since it's in stock, but I suspect it's L.  Which leads me to…

      2. Have any of you, particularly those in the US, ordered from Rakuten?  They seem to have the L in stock, but ordering seems like a pretty daunting task:
      http://en.item.rakuten.com/hinoya/ihsh-31/

      Any help will be much appreciated.  Thanks!
